Configuration des packages

Architecture d'un package :

Azure-Config-Intune
  1. Les fichiers d'installation : Contient les fichiers nécessaires à l'installation du logiciel (formats possibles : exe, msi,msp ...), fournis par l'éditeur.
  2. Le fichier de configuration quand c'est nécessaire : Permet d'inclure la licence ou de désactiver les messages de mises à jour automatique par exemple. (formats possibles : xml, ini, json, ...)
  3. Le logo du logiciel : Un fichier PNG (400x400px) représentant le logo du logiciel (Ne pas renommer ce fichier)
    Utilisation :
    • Affichage dans le Centre logiciel (SCCM) ou le portail d'entreprise (Intune).
    • Message pour demander à l'utilisateur de fermer le logiciel avant une mise à jour (optionnel, voir documentation sur les arguments d'installation : CLOSEAPPMESSAGE)
  4. La librairie WinAppack au format dll (Pour plus d'information : voir la documentation de cette librairie)
  5. Script PowerShell d'installation/désinstallation :
    • Un script PowerShell permettant d'installer ou de désinstaller le logiciel en mode silencieux via le compte System NT.
    • Personnalisation : Vous pouvez modifier ce script pour l'adapter à votre environnement. Toutefois, des modifications peuvent affecter le bon déroulement des processus d'installation/désinstallation.
  6. Script PowerShell pour détecter si l'installation est effective ou non. Utilisé par Microsoft Intune et SCCM.
  7. Script PowerShell pour intégrer le package dans Microsoft Intune.
  8. Script PowerShell pour intégrer le package dans MECM (SCCM).
  9. Script CMD pour lancer l'installation manuellement avec le compte System. C'est à dire, exactement dans les mêmes conditions qu'un déploiement avec Intune ou SCCM. Important : Il faut l'éxecuter avec un compte admin et que votre EDR autorise l'execution de l'outil Microsoft PsExec.exe
  10. Script CMD pour lancer la désinstallation manuellement avec le compte System comme pour le script d'installation. Remarque : Le script propose 2 options : Une désinstallation normale ou une désinstallation avancée permettant de supprimer tous les fichiers résiduels laissés par le logiciel en question.
  11. Utilitaire Microsoft PsExec.exe nécessaire pour lancer l'installation manuelle.

Le package est prêt à être intégré dans votre outil de télédistribution.